BAM appoints Nova Widianto as mixed doubles coach

KUALA LUMPUR – The Badminton Association of Malaysia has appointed two-time former mixed doubles world champion Nova Widianto as mixed doubles coach for next year’s Paris Olympics.

The 45-year-old has signed for two years and will be reporting to doubles coaching director Rexy Mainaky.

Rexy said that the national mixed doubles players are excited at the prospect of having a coach of his calibre helping them.

“Nova’s knowledge and volume of experience will be extremely valuable to the current players in the squad, especially with the qualifying competitions for the Paris Olympics beginning next year,” said Rexy.

The national team is expected to significantly improve their performance with Nova on board.

Nova is widely regarded as one of the best mixed doubles players of his era.

He won the world championships in 2005 and 2007 and was a silver medallist at the 2008 Olympics with Liliyana Natsir. – The Vibes, December 21, 2022
